Staking Score
Staking That Rewards Time, Not Just Timing
Staking and unstaking in the GBM Protocol are instant, with no bonding or unbonding delays.
Your share of any governance-approved reward distribution is based on your total staking score, which combines two factors:
⏳ 1. Accumulated Score
The Accumulated Score rewards loyalty. It increases every second your tokens remain staked and represents your long-term staking contribution.
Formula: Accumulated Score = Time staked × Tokens staked × Stake Coefficient
Example: You stake 100 GBM tokens for 90 days (7,776,000 seconds) with a Stake Coefficient of 2. Accumulated Score = 7,776,000 × 100 × 2 = 1,555,200,000 points
Unstaking stops your score from growing, but your earned points remain intact. The Stake Coefficient starts at 2 and can be updated by governance.
⚡ 2. Instant Score
The Instant Score is a bonus awarded for presence. It rewards anyone still staked at the final snapshot, even if they joined late in the period.
Formula: Instant Score = Time elapsed × Tokens staked
Example: You stake 100 GBM tokens for the last 10 days of a 90-day reward period. Time elapsed = 864,000 seconds Instant Score = 864,000 × 100 = 86,400,000
This ensures that even short-term stakers earn a share for being active when the final snapshot is taken.
🧮 Total Score
Your Total Score determines your proportional share of the reward pool.
It combines both long-term loyalty (Accumulated Score) and presence (Instant Score).
Formula: Total Score = (Accumulated Score + Instant Score) ÷ (Time elapsed × (1 + Stake Coefficient))
🧠 Example: Comparing Stakers
Imagine a 90-day reward period with a Stake Coefficient of 2.
Alice stakes 100 tokens from day 1 and remains staked for the full 90 days. Bob stakes 100 tokens for the final 10 days of the period.
Alice’s Accumulated Score: 7,776,000 × 100 × 2 = 1,555,200,000
Bob’s Accumulated Score: 864,000 × 100 × 2 = 172,800,000
Alice’s Instant Score: 7,776,000 × 100 = 777,600,000
Bob’s Instant Score: 7,776,000 × 100 = 777,600,000
Total Score (using full 90-day period = 7,776,000 seconds): Alice → (1,555,200,000 + 777,600,000) ÷ (7,776,000 × 3) = 2,332,800,000 Bob → (172,800,000 + 777,600,000) ÷ (7,776,000 × 3) = 950,400,000
Alice earns roughly 2.45 times more total points than Bob because she staked for longer, but Bob still receives a small bonus for being active at the end.
What This System Ensures
Long-term stakers build higher scores
Late joiners still receive fair credit
Unstaking early stops score growth, but does not erase what you’ve earned
